Man Charged With Stealing $55,000 Worth Of Comic Books

Man Kept 35,000 Comic Books In Storage

POSTED: 5:49 p.m. EDT July 15, 2002
UPDATED: 9:26 a.m. EDT July 25, 2002

Authorities in Seminole County, Fla., have reportedly arrested a 22-year-old man in connection with the theft of $55,000 worth of comic books from a storage facility, according to Local 6 News.

Douglas Korinke, 49, said that he kept his collection of 35,000 comic books at the Public Storage facility located at 2431 S. Orange Blossom Trail, near Apopka, Fla.

Korinke said that an employee of the storage facility contacted him earlier this month and let him know about about the theft, according to a release from the Seminole County Sheriff's Office.

Authorities said a tip from comic book store operator helped them apprehend Shannon Bickel Wednesday.

Bickel faces charges burglary, larceny and dealing in stolen property.

An investigator estimated that 90 percent of the victim's property has been recovered, including a rare edition of the "Spider Man" comic series.
